About IBIL, Sir Hugh Laddie and the Sir Hugh Laddie Chair
When Sir Hugh retired from the bench in 2005 heÌýwas appointed Professor of Intellectual Property Law at °×С½ãÂÛ̳ and went on to foundÌýthe Institute of Brand and Innovation Law. Following his death in November 2008, and with the endorsement of his family, °×С½ãÂÛ̳ set about creating an academic Chair funded by charitable contributions in his memory.ÌýThe inaugural holder of the Sir Hugh Laddie Chair in Intellectual Property Law is Professor Sir Robin Jacob who is also Director of the °×С½ãÂÛ̳ Institute of Brand and Innovation Law.

The Sir Hugh Laddie Chair in Intellectual Property
The Sir Hugh Laddie Chair is an integral part of the Institute of Brand and Innovation Law, the living, practical IP academic centre founded by Sir Hugh at °×С½ãÂÛ̳ Laws. Like Sir Hugh, the Chair is reserved for one of the most respected voices in the legal world.
